Subject: Re: [PATCH v3 1/1] RISC-V: Add common csr_read_num() and csr_write_num()
functions
On Thu, 30 Oct 2025, Anup Patel wrote:
> On Thu, Oct 30, 2025 at 12:35 AM Paul Walmsley <pjw@...nel.org> wrote:
> > On Tue, 14 Oct 2025, Anup Patel wrote:
> >
> > > In RISC-V, there is no CSR read/write instruction which takes CSR
> > > number via register so add common csr_read_num() and csr_write_num()
> > > functions which allow accessing certain CSRs by passing CSR number
> > > as parameter. These common functions will be first used by the
> > > ACPI CPPC driver and RISC-V PMU driver.
> >

>
> The switch case is incomplete for cppc_ffh_csr_read().
> Also, csr_read_num() already does appropriate filtering
> so the switch case over here is now redundant.
>

> > I'm thinking that we probably want to keep the CSR number filtering code
> > in; at least, I can't think of a good reason to remove it. Care to add it
> > back in?
>
> We can potentially have custom CSRs as hardware counters
> hence the CSR filtering over here is already incomplete. Plus,
> csr_read_num() already does the CSR filtering and returns
> failure for inappropriate CSR number.
OK. To me, the most notable changes in this patch are the changes in the
filters for both reads and writes for the two different call sites, ACPI
FFH and PMU. It would be good to document these filter changes directly
in the patch description, along with the rationale.
I'm also not yet completely convinced that we should allow both of these
call sites to read and write any custom CSR. But maybe the updated patch
description might be convincing...
